Common Gelco Chimney Cleaning Problems We Solve in Post Falls

  • Creosote glazing inside Gelco metal flues. Post Falls homeowners burn cheap cordwood six months straight—October through March—and that sustained firing with often unseasoned timber deposits glazed creosote far faster than occasional gas fireplace use. In a Gelco G-Series or Elite Series flue, that glaze restricts draft and becomes a genuine fire hazard. We remove it with rotary whipping systems sized for Gelco’s factory-built metal liners, not masonry brushes that miss the corners.
  • Outer casing corrosion from Rathdrum Prairie freeze-thaw cycling. The elevation and river-valley proximity here produce temperature swings that crack chimney crowns and deteriorate prefab metal casings faster than in drier climates to the south. Gelco zero-clearance units from the 1995–2010 era are particularly vulnerable once their outer jacket sealant ages. We inspect for casing integrity during every Level 2 inspection and can reseal or cap before water reaches the insulation layer.
  • Damper warpage and seal failure. Dense cordwood fires in Post Falls’s long heating season sustain higher temperatures than the occasional romantic fire. Gelco dampers—especially in pre-2005 units—warp at the hinge point and lose their seal, letting conditioned air escape year-round and drawing smoke into living spaces on windy days. We source OEM Gelco dampers when available and carry quality aftermarket replacements for common widths.
  • Smoke spillage from cracked inner firebox panels. This is the big one in Post Falls’s 1990s–2000s subdivisions. The G-Series units installed across entire production runs develop stress cracks at identical fatigue points—typically the rear panel weld seam after 20+ years of thermal cycling. Our Level 2 inspection includes fiber-optic camera examination of this exact area, and we stock replacement panels for the most common Gelco configurations found in local tract homes.
  • Cap and crown deterioration letting water into the flue system. Post Falls’s wet shoulder seasons—heavy spring runoff, fall rains before the first freeze—mean a missing or rusted cap becomes an immediate problem. We install Gelco-compatible caps from Copperfield and Famco, sized for multi-flue or single-flue configurations, with proper spark arrestor mesh that doesn’t clog with the fine ash from dense hardwood fires common here.

Gelco Models & Products We Service in Post Falls

We work on the full Gelco prefab lineup found in Post Falls homes: the G-Series units that dominated 1995–2005 production, the Elite Series with its upgraded door assembly and improved damper design, and the various builder-grade zero-clearance boxes installed through roughly 2010. These aren’t masonry systems— they’re engineered metal assemblies with specific clearances, panel configurations, and venting requirements that change by model year.

Our parts approach is straightforward. OEM Gelco dampers, doors, and firebox panels when they’re available and the unit’s age justifies the investment. High-grade aftermarket alternatives—Copperfield caps, DuraFlex liner sections, HeatShield crown coatings—when OEM is discontinued, back-ordered, or simply overpriced for the remaining service life of the fireplace. Gelco Service Pricing in Post Falls

  • Standard Gelco chimney sweep and Level 2 inspection: $180–$240
  • Creosote removal with rotary system (heavy glaze): $220–$290
  • Gelco damper replacement (OEM or aftermarket): $280–$420
  • Inner firebox panel replacement (G-Series/Elite): $340–$580
  • Cap replacement with Copperfield or Famco unit: $180–$320
  • Full liner rebuild with DuraFlex: $1,800–$3,200

What drives cost? Accessibility of the flue, severity of creosote buildup, and whether we’re cleaning or replacing components. A straightforward sweep on a well-maintained Gelco Elite in Prairie View runs toward the lower end. A G-Series in Greensferry Estates with glazed creosote, a cracked panel, and a seized damper lands higher—and we’ll show you exactly why before any work starts.
